Understanding a Fluorescent Light Diffuser
A fluorescent light diffuser is a panel or cover placed over fluorescent or LED light fixtures to distribute light evenly throughout a room. Instead of allowing bright light to shine directly from the bulbs, the diffuser softens and spreads illumination, creating a more balanced and comfortable atmosphere.
Manufactured from high-quality acrylic or polycarbonate materials, modern diffusers are designed to offer durability, excellent light transmission, and long-lasting performance.

Different Types of Fluorescent Light Diffusers
Choosing the right diffuser depends on your lighting needs and the style of your fixture.
Prismatic Diffusers
Designed with small prism patterns, these diffusers reduce glare while maximizing light output. They are commonly used in offices, educational facilities, and commercial buildings.
Frosted Diffusers
Frosted panels provide a softer, more even glow, making them ideal for residential spaces, reception areas, and hospitality settings.
Egg Crate Diffusers
Featuring an open-grid design, egg crate diffusers improve airflow while reducing direct glare. They are often installed in retail stores, warehouses, and industrial facilities.
Decorative Diffusers
Decorative panels add personality to a space with unique textures or printed designs while maintaining effective light diffusion. These are popular in healthcare facilities, children's spaces, and creative work environments.

Tips for Selecting the Right Fluorescent Light Diffuser
When choosing a replacement diffuser, consider the following:
- Measure your existing fixture accurately.
- Select acrylic for excellent clarity or polycarbonate for enhanced impact resistance.
- Choose a diffuser pattern that matches your desired lighting effect.
- Ensure compatibility with your existing fixture.
- Consider custom-sized panels if your fixture requires a non-standard fit.
A properly fitted diffuser ensures optimal performance and a professional finish.

Simple Maintenance for Long-Lasting Performance
Keeping your diffuser clean helps maintain bright and efficient lighting. Follow these simple maintenance tips:
- Dust regularly using a soft microfiber cloth.
- Wash with warm water and mild soap when needed.
- Avoid abrasive cleaners or rough scrubbing pads.
- Inspect panels for damage during routine maintenance.
- Replace cracked or brittle diffusers promptly.
Routine care helps preserve both appearance and performance.
